    Fractals

    for those who dont know what a fractal is...

    Quote Originally Posted by Wikipedia
    A fractal is generally "a rough or fragmented geometric shape that can be split into parts, each of which is (at least approximately) a reduced-size copy of the whole," a property called self-similarity.
